jan 23, 1940 - BCATP

Description:

In 1940, The British Commonwealth Air Training Plan (BCATP), or Empire Air Training Scheme (EATS) often referred to as simply "The Plan", was a big military aircrew training program created by the United Kingdom, Canada, Australia and New Zealand, during the Second World War. This showed progress for Canada, since it trained nearly half the pilots, navigators, bomb aimers, air gunners, wireless operators and flight engineers who served with the Royal Canadian Air Force.
